The only circumstance in which an area heating system is eco-friendly or power effective is when it's used to reduce the quantity of energy a central heating system makes use of. If you work from home, making use of a space heating system can be a great way to maintain your office comfy without warming the extra spaces in the rest of the house.
As a whole, one square foot of area calls for regarding 10 watts of electrical power to warm, which means that an area heater operating at its maximum result can heat an area no larger than 150 square feet. According to the National Fire Security Organization, area heaters and home heating ranges was in charge of the biggest shares of losses in home heating tools fires from 2018-2022, accounting for almost half of the fires.

DON'T make use of an extension cord or power strip with an electrical space heating system. DO maintain the area heating unit away from combustible things (3 feet is a good regulation of thumb).
DON'T use an area heating system if the cord appears to be harmed or is warm to the touch. DO location the space heating system on a hard, degree, nonflammable surface area. While it is essential to only operate area heating systems each time and in a location where they can be kept track of by a liable adult, there are a variety of safety functions that can give you added assurance.
Automatic shut-off in the occasion of overheating. A thermostat that checks the interior temperature. Independent certification (such as UL) indicates that the product has been evaluated and fulfills specific clinical safety and security, quality, or security standards. Cool-touch housing, to avoid unexpected get in touch with burns. Multiple temperature setups will enable you to choose the most affordable temperature for your demands, so you're not paying even more to overheat your space.

Tiny area heaters are normally made use of when the primary home heating system is not available, poor, or when central home heating is as well costly to mount or run. In many cases, tiny area heaters can be cheaper to utilize if you only want to warmth one area or supplement inadequate heating in one area.
Little space heating systems function by convection (the read this post here circulation of air in a space) or radiant heat. Radiant heating units emit infrared radiation that straight heats up things and individuals within their line of vision, and are a more reliable choice when you will be in a space for just a couple of hours and can stay within the line of sight of the heater.
Security is a top factor to consider when using little room heaters. The United State Consumer Item Safety Commission estimates that even more than 1,700 domestic anchor fires every year are related to the usage of space heating units, causing greater than 80 deaths and 160 injuries country wide - 1 Source Portable Air. Space heater capacities normally range in between 10,000 Btu and 40,000 Btu per hour, and typically run on power, lp, natural gas, and kerosene (see wood and pellet heating for information on timber and pellet stoves). When buying and installing a tiny room heating system, adhere to these guidelines: Newer model little space heating systems have current safety and security attributes.

Choose a thermostatically regulated heating unit, because they prevent the power waste of overheating an area. Select a heating unit of the appropriate dimension for the room you wish to warm.
A space heating unit is a device utilized for home heating spaces and enclosed rooms. A lot of room heaters are electric, but some outdoor designs make use of natural gas or lp.
Nowadays, they come with safety functions that immediately turned off the device when any tipping or water is found. Area heating units can be used along with your home's existing heating systemlike radiators or compelled airor as a standalone heating resource in a place without any kind look at here of integrated heat resource.

These heaters are filled with oil and have metal fins to radiate the warm. They are frequently called "radiator heating units" since they look like standard radiators discovered in older residences.
Another pro is that they're peaceful, unlike fan-based area heating systems. These heating units are hot to the touch, making it simple for pets, children, and grownups to erroneously burn themselves. Due to the fact that the oil is combustible, there's constantly the danger of the device capturing fire. Tipping is a specifically usual fire danger, but lots of more recent room heaters have an automated shut-off when tipping is spotted.
